Despite a furious rally to tie the game midway through the third quarter, the No. 22-ranked San Diego State water polo team could not keep pace with top-seeded Loyola Marymount, falling 16-10 in Saturday’s Golden Coast Conference (GCC) Tournament semifinal at Burns Aquatic Center.
After trailing by three goals at halftime, the fourth-seeded Aztecs (15-14) stormed back to even the score at 8-8 with 5:17 remaining in the third quarter, sparked by goals from Mimi Stoupas, Sydney Gish, and a second strike from Stoupas.
